FA28X7R1E684KRU00 Ceramic Capacitor (Leaded MLCC)

FA28X7R1E684KRU00 is a high-performance ceramic capacitor manufactured by TDK, a global leader in electronic components. This leaded Multi-Layer Ceramic Capacitor (MLCC) is specifically designed for demanding applications, particularly within the automotive sector, where reliability and stability are paramount. As a passive component, its primary function is to store and release electrical energy, filter noise, and stabilize voltage in electronic circuits. The FA28X7R1E684KRU00 stands out due to its AEC-Q200 qualification, ensuring it meets the stringent requirements for automotive electronics, making it an ideal choice for critical systems.

Key Specifications

This TDK ceramic capacitor boasts several critical specifications that define its performance and suitability for various applications. The ‘Apps.’ attribute indicates it is an ‘Automotive Grade’ component, signifying its robustness and compliance with industry standards for vehicle electronics. The ‘Brand’ is TDK, a testament to its quality and reliability. Its ‘Feature’ set includes ‘AEC-Q200 General Halogen-free’, highlighting its environmental compliance and suitability for automotive use. The ‘AEC-Q200’ attribute explicitly confirms its qualification, which is crucial for automotive system designers. A ‘Tolerance’ of ‘±10%’ for its capacitance value of ‘680nF’ means the actual capacitance will be within 10% of 680 nanofarads, a common and acceptable range for many filtering and coupling applications. The physical dimensions are critical for PCB layout and fit: ‘L(Max.) / mm’ is ‘4’, ‘W(Max.) / mm’ is ‘5.5’, and ‘T(Max.) / mm’ is ‘2.5’, defining its maximum length, width, and thickness respectively. The ‘F(Nom.) / mm’ of ‘5’ likely refers to the nominal lead spacing. The ‘Temp. Chara.’ of ‘X7R’ indicates a dielectric material suitable for a wide operating temperature range (-55°C to +125°C) with a capacitance change of no more than ±15%, making it stable across varying thermal conditions. The ‘Rated Voltage [DC] / V’ is ’25’, specifying the maximum DC voltage it can continuously withstand. Finally, the ‘Lead Length / Package Type’ is ‘7mm for Bulk’, indicating the physical configuration of its leads for through-hole mounting.

Features and Benefits

  • Automotive Grade Reliability: The FA28X7R1E684KRU00 is AEC-Q200 qualified, ensuring exceptional reliability and performance under the harsh conditions typical of automotive environments, including wide temperature variations and mechanical stress.
  • Stable Performance: With an X7R temperature characteristic, this capacitor maintains stable capacitance over a broad operating temperature range (-55°C to +125°C), crucial for consistent circuit operation in critical applications.
  • Halogen-Free Construction: Adherence to halogen-free standards demonstrates TDK’s commitment to environmental responsibility, making it suitable for eco-conscious designs and compliant with various environmental regulations.
  • Versatile Capacitance: A 680nF capacitance with ±10% tolerance provides sufficient energy storage and filtering capabilities for a wide array of general-purpose and specialized electronic circuits.
  • Robust Leaded Design: The leaded MLCC format with 7mm leads for bulk packaging offers ease of through-hole mounting, providing mechanical stability and robust electrical connections, particularly in vibration-prone applications.

Typical Applications

The FA28X7R1E684KRU00 ceramic capacitor’s robust design and automotive-grade qualification make it suitable for a diverse range of applications:
  • Automotive Infotainment Systems: Used in car radios, navigation systems, and display units for power supply decoupling, signal filtering, and timing circuits, ensuring clear audio and stable operation.
  • Engine Control Units (ECUs): Critical for filtering noise in power lines and stabilizing voltage rails within ECUs, contributing to the precise control of engine functions and overall vehicle performance.
  • Advanced Driver-Assistance Systems (ADAS): Employed in sensors, cameras, and radar modules for noise suppression and power conditioning, vital for the accurate operation of safety-critical ADAS features like adaptive cruise control and lane-keeping assist.
  • Electric Vehicle (EV) Charging Systems: Integrated into on-board chargers and DC-DC converters for filtering high-frequency ripple and improving power efficiency, crucial for reliable EV charging infrastructure.
  • Industrial Control Systems: Beyond automotive, its high reliability and temperature stability make it ideal for industrial automation, robotics, and power supplies where consistent performance in harsh environments is required.
